Wimbledon 2026: Noskova Triumphs, Sinner Prepares for Men's Final
In a thrilling conclusion to the women's singles at Wimbledon 2026, Linda Noskova emerged victorious, defeating Karolina Muchova in a hotly contested final. This special broadcast from Radio 5 Live delves into the immediate aftermath of this significant match, offering listeners insights into Noskova's triumph and Muchova's performance. The program also sets the stage for the highly anticipated men's final, where defending champion Jannik Sinner is poised to face Alexander Zverev. Beyond the singles courts, the episode celebrates notable achievements in the doubles events, spotlighting the remarkable success of British players.
The broadcast opens with an immediate reaction to Noskova's win, featuring expert commentary from Pat Cash and correspondent Russell Fuller, who join Gigi Salmon to dissect the key moments and strategies of the women's final. Listeners are treated to exclusive interviews with Linda Noskova, offering her perspective on the monumental victory, and Karolina Muchova, who shares her reflections on the championship match. These segments provide a deeper understanding of the athletes' emotions and their journey through the tournament.
Following the women's final analysis, the focus shifts to the upcoming men's final. Pat Cash and Russell Fuller offer a detailed preview of the clash between Jannik Sinner, aiming to retain his title, and Alexander Zverev. Their discussion covers potential strategies, player forms, and predictions for what promises to be an exciting encounter, building anticipation for the decisive match.
The program also shines a light on the doubles events, celebrating the exceptional performance of British players. Gordon Reid and Alfie Hewett share their thoughts after securing their seventh Wimbledon doubles title, a testament to their enduring partnership and skill. Additionally, Henry Patten and Finland's Harry Heliovaara discuss their successful defense of the men's doubles title, highlighting the international collaboration and competitive spirit present in the tournament.
